Zapata won a close one the last time they played, but unfortunately they suffered a serious change of fortune on Saturday. They came up short against the Economedes Jaguars, falling 35-15. The matchup marked the Hawks' lowest-scoring game so far this season.
Economedes got their win on the backs of several key players, but it was Nathaniel De La Garza out in front who posted 14 points. The team also got some help courtesy of Alexandro Zurita, who put up nine points and five rebounds.
Zapata dropped their record down to 7-9 with the loss, which was their fifth straight at home. As for Economedes, their victory bumped their record up to 13-9.
Both teams are looking forward to the support of their home crowds in their upcoming games. Zapata and Edinburg will round out the year against one another at at 2:30 p.m. on Monday. Edinburg knows how to get points on the board -- the squad has finished with 55 points or more in their past four contests -- so hopefully Zapata likes a good challenge. As for Economedes, they will look to defend their home court on Monday against Grulla at 1:30 p.m. Economedes is facing Grulla at the right time seeing as Grulla is stuck on an eight-game losing streak.
